目前,我们的存储库包含以下分支:
目前,一旦我们从master创建了一个发布分支,并说我在master上有一个更改也应该在发布分支上,我必须cherry-pick
提交到发布分支。
除了cherry-pick
导致提交哈希值发生变化之外,这基本上没有问题,因此在与其他团队成员通信时很难引用特定提交,并且很难分辨出提交存在哪些分支英寸
由于与未来版本相关的提交可能存在于master中,因此无论何时进行更改,我们都无法将master合并到发布分支上。
是否有可以解决此问题的特定git工作流程?或者也许我们可以改变我们的工作流程以避免它?
如果有帮助,这是一个包含< 10开发者的私人仓库。